The LLCC binding and driver was recently corrected to handle the stride
varying between platforms. Switch to the new format to ensure accesses
are done in the right place.

Pin configuration property "input-enable" was used with the intention to
disable the output, but this is done by default by Linux drivers. Since
commit c4a48b0df8 ("dt-bindings: pinctrl: qcom: tlmm should use
output-disable, not input-enable") the property is not accepted anymore:
sc8180x-primus.dtb: pinctrl@3100000: hall-int-active-state: 'oneOf' conditional failed, one must be fixed:
'bias-disable', 'function', 'input-enable', 'pins' do not match any of the regexes: '-pins$', 'pinctrl-[0-9]+'

The VCC and VCCA supplies of the DSI<->eDP bridge are derived from
vreg_l2a_1p2 and controlled by a GPIO on the PMIC. Add the regulator
here so Linux can control it.
